Manganese(II) chloride describes a series of compounds with the formula MnCl2(H2O)x, where the value of x can be 0, 2, or 4. Like many Mn(II) species, these salts are pink, the paleness of the color being characteristic of transition metal complexes with high spin d5 configurations.

Minimum Assay: >98%
Molecular Formula: Cl2Mn•4H2
Molecular Weight: 197.90 (125.84anhy) 
Appearance Form: crystalline
Colour: light red
pH: 4.0 – 6 at 99 g/l at 25°C
Melting point/range: 58°C
Relative density 1.913 g/cm3
Water solubility: 99 g/l at 20°C – completely soluble

Hazard Phrases: Harmful if swallowed. Causes serious eye irritation. Toxic to aquatic life with long lasting effects.

Prec Phrases: Wash hands thoroughly after handling. Avoid release to the environment.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ection. If eye irritation persists: Get medical advice/attention. Collect spillage. Dispose of contents/container.

 

Cas No: 13446-34-9
Einecs No: 231-869-6
UN3077
